C# string array vs string list
WebJun 13, 2024 · ArrayList belongs to System.Collection namespace. Data Type. In Arrays, we can store only one datatype either int, string, char etc. In ArrayList we can store different datatype variables. Operation Speed. Insertion and deletion operation is fast. Insertion and deletion operation in ArrayList is slower than an Array. Typed. WebFeb 7, 2016 · The second one is a normal 2 dimensional array ( Multi Dimensional Array ). In a nutshell , [,] is a 2d array allocated all at once, while [] [] is an array of arrays thus …
C# string array vs string list
Did you know?
WebC# Strings. In C#, string is an object of System.String class that represent sequence of characters. We can perform many operations on strings such as concatenation, comparision, getting substring, search, trim, replacement etc. string vs String. In C#, string is keyword which is an alias for System.String class. That is why string and String ... WebC# - ArrayList. In C#, the ArrayList is a non-generic collection of objects whose size increases dynamically. It is the same as Array except that its size increases dynamically.. An ArrayList can be used to add unknown …
WebThe LINQ Contains Method in C# is used to check whether a sequence or collection (i.e. data source) contains a specified element or not. If the data source contains the specified element, then it returns true else returns false. There are there Contains Methods available in C# and they are implemented in two different namespaces. WebApr 7, 2024 · To concatenate multiple interpolated strings, add the $ special character to each string literal. The structure of an item with an interpolation expression is as follows: C#. { [,] [:]} Elements in square brackets are optional.
WebIn C#, an string your a series of graphic that is used to represent text. It can be a drawing, an word or ampere long gateway surrounded with the duplex quoted ". ... In C#, a string is a collection or an array of characters. So, string can be created using a char range or accessed like ampere char array. Example: Line as char Array. WebMar 31, 2024 · In structural programming we pass arrays as arguments to methods. The entire contents of the array are not copied—just the small reference. Step 1 We create an int array of 3 integer elements—these are 3 negative integers. Step 2 We pass a reference to the array (this is like an integer itself) to the method.
WebJun 20, 2024 · An array is a collection of homogenous parts, while a list consists of heterogeneous elements. Array memory is static and …
WebSep 15, 2024 · To concatenate string variables, you can use the + or += operators, string interpolation or the String.Format, String.Concat, String.Join or StringBuilder.Append methods. The + operator is easy to use and makes for intuitive code. Even if you use several + operators in one statement, the string content is copied only once. topics.grWebNov 21, 2011 · Array is based on static memory allocation and List is based on dynamic memory allocation concept. If you know the number of element you are going to store you can choose Array otherwise you can go with List. Same time List provide you a set of easy to use method like Add, Remove, Clear, Insert, Find which array does not provide. topics hair salon ptcWebNov 14, 2024 · C# List C# Array; 1. Length: A list in C# can be dynamically resized when items are added or removed. The size of an array is fixed, therefore it can only store a fixed number of elements of the same data type. 2. Namespace: C# List class comes under the System.Collection.Generic namespace: Array belongs to the System.Array namespace … pictures of open kitchen shelvingWebDec 6, 2024 · The elements of the array are initialized to the default value of the element type, 0 for integers. Arrays can store any element type you specify, such as the following example that declares an array of strings: string[] stringArray = new string[6]; Array Initialization. You can initialize the elements of an array when you declare the array. topics home pageWebFeb 1, 2024 · String. 01. An array is a data structure that stores a collection of elements of the same data type. A string is basically treated as an object which represents a sequence of characters. An array. 02. Array can hold any of the data types. But, the String can hold only a char data type. 03. topics hey girlWebC# Dictionary Versus List Lookup Time Both lists and dictionaries are used to store collections of data. A Dictionary int, T > and List T > are similar, both are random access data structures of the .NET framework.The Dictionary is based on a hash table, that means it uses a hash lookup, which is a rather efficient algorithm to look up things, on the other … pictures of open kitchen shelvesWebJul 28, 2014 · List might be a little faster actually. It is kindof a wrapper around the pre-generic ArrayList. There's no boxing/unboxing, but there is still an extra step or two under the hood, IIRC. StringCollection was handy before .NET 2.0 because it was strongly typed to string, very common thing to want a list of. topics i am interested in